Almost all ram chips placed such so the length of traces on the PCB are matched: the distance electrons have to travel affects timings.
GDDR5 have much higher latency than normal DDR3 but also higher bandwidth. Suitable for GPU use.
DDR3 have less latency(tighter timings) but also lower bandwidth. Suitable for CPU use.
